Subject: Tomb Of The Aztecs V1.0 (A 3D 7DRL) Released
It's a pleasure to present for your amusement my little unofficial 7DRL; a
3D realtime raytraced dungeon crawl using libtcod.

Download: http://www.coldcity.com/downloads/tota.rar (630K rar file)

You will need a fast PC running Windows I'm afraid; suggest 2Ghz+.

See included readme for controls, a project log and notes. I'll release the
source if people want it.

I'm deeply sorry for the Windows-only binary. It compiles fine on Linux but
currently segfaults; hopefully I can rectify that in a follow-up release.
